Nokia's new 6133 and 6131 score FCC approval

The FCC has just approved the quad-band 6131 and its look-alike – the 6133. The 6131 was announced at the 3GSM 2006, while there is still no official word on the 6133. The 6133 model is identical with the 6131, apart from a small difference in the design. The 6133 redesigns the numeric keypad of the 6131, adding some metal trim. Probably Nokia produced the 6133 as a variant of the 6131, targeting it to a different mobile carrier. Nokia 6131/6133 main specifications are:

  • Quad-band GSM “world” phone with GPRS/EDGE support
  • QVGA 240x320, 16mln color display
  • Music player supporting various formats
  • microSD memory expansion
  • Internet browser, E-Mail client
  • Bluetooth, Infrared, USB
